- adjective intensively of, relating to, or characterized by intensity: intensive questioning. 1
- adjective intensively tending to intensify; intensifying. 1
- adjective intensively Medicine/Medical. increasing in intensity or degree. instituting treatment to the limit of safety. 1
- adjective intensively noting or pertaining to a system of agriculture involving the cultivation of limited areas, and relying on the maximum use of labor and expenditures to raise the crop yield per unit area (opposed to extensive). 1
- adjective intensively requiring or having a high concentration of a specified quality or element (used in combination): Coal mining is a labor-intensive industry. 1
- adjective intensively Grammar. indicating increased emphasis or force. Certainly is an intensive adverb. Myself in I did it myself is an intensive pronoun. 1
